2.4.2. 裸机整数 C

如果使用 C 编写的程序不使用库,并且无需进行任何环境初始化即可运行,则必须:

很多库功能需要使用 __user_libspace 来处理静态数据。 即使没有使用 main() 函数激活初始化代码,也会自动创建 __user_libspace,并且它使用 ZI 段中的 96 个字节。 有关 __user_libspace 区的说明,请参阅__user_libspace 静态数据区

Copyright © 2007 ARM Limited. All rights reserved. ARM DUI 0349AC
Non-Confidential